I’ve tried to include as much information here as possible. Please read and consider carefully before sending me a message. ————————————————— THE BIG QUESTION: how much does it cost? I offer three service options at varying price points, with minimum fees ranging from $200-$450. Each service option includes menu planning, shopping, in-home cooking, and cleanup. Groceries are billed separately. Rates are determined after a consultation and trial session. My rates are per diem, and can vary significantly depending on the client’s individual preferences; therefore, I’m unable to quote an exact rate without completing a trial session. For reference only, I’ve included my minimum rates below. Option 1: Full-Day Meal Prep One service day will typically yield a week’s worth of lunches and dinners, which will be stored in your fridge & can be reheated at your convenience. Full-day meal prep service can be scheduled weekly or every other week. My minimum rate for full-day meal prep is $350. Option 2: Half-Day Meal Prep One half-day of service will typically yield two days’ worth of lunches and dinners, which will be stored in your fridge & can be reheated at your convenience. Half-day meal prep service can be scheduled 1-3x per week. My minimum rate for half-day service is $200. Availability may vary by location. Option 3: Daily Chef Service: One day of service will yield a single day of meals. This is a premium option, and the overall cost will be higher compared to meal prep. Meals will be served hot, rather than stored & reheated. My minimum rate for daily service is $450. Rates are negotiable if salaried. ————————————————— TRIAL SESSION RATES, and how it all works: For the trial session, you will be charged $40/hr, billed hourly. Groceries will be billed separately, and a grocery deposit will be required. Prior to your trial session, we’ll discuss your needs and food preferences. I’ll send you a list of menu ideas, and you’ll select what you’d like to try — or, you can send me your own recipes to prepare. I’ll create a shopping list and send it to you for approval. You’ll be able to check off any items you already have. I’ll pick up organic groceries at the Wedge Co-op before heading to your home, where I’ll cook, clean up, label your meals, and store them in the fridge. (Or, for daily service clients: I will cook, serve your meals, clean up, and put away any leftovers). Finally, I will send an invoice & a grocery receipt for reimbursement. Acceptable forms of payment include cash, check, PayPal, and Venmo. Unfortunately, I cannot accept credit card payments. ————————————————— WHAT ELSE? Read on to learn a little bit more about me: … I began my culinary journey as a teenager, cooking free weekly meals for anyone in need, with food that would otherwise go to waste. For the past decade, I’ve also cooked for several large-scale social justice movements. I have seven years of experience working for families and individuals, and I am a MN state-certified Food Safety Manager. I also have a certificate in Pastry Arts from Amaury Guichon’s Pastry Academy in Las Vegas, NV, and I’m a state-certified Wild Mushroom Harvester. My specialties and interests include: vegetarian, pescatarian, and vegan diets; Indian, Persian, Eastern European, and Levantine cuisines (to name just a few!); fermentation and preservation; and foraging & local foods.
